Statute of limitations

The statute of limitations can be complicated due to the fact that asbestos-related diseases such as mesothelioma may take years to manifest. A knowledgeable lawyer can assist victims in determining their deadlines, and then filing within the timeframes. The lawyer will go over the claim, inform defendants, construct the case by presenting evidence, and either negotiate a settlement or plead for a jury verdict at trial.

The statute of limitations for states that are specific to personal injury and wrongful deaths cases vary. The time limit is influenced by a variety of factors, such as the date of the asbestos exposure and the state in which the victim worked, and the location of asbestos-related businesses.

The majority of asbestos victims benefit from the rule of discovery that allows a statute of limitations clock to begin at the point the disease was discovered or when it should be reasonably discovered. This differs from the state's statutory periods which usually start on the date of exposure.

The statute of limitations may be extended, or even paused in certain situations, like when the victim is a minor or lacks legal capacity to file. It is also possible that the statute of limitations will be extended in specific cases such as cases of fraudulent concealment.

If the statute of limitations runs out before a mesothelioma suit is filed, victims could lose their opportunity for compensation. They may have other options to receive financial compensation, including trust funds and insurance.

Asbestos Trust Funds

Trust funds are accessible to asbestos victims who suffer from ailments such as mesothelioma and other asbestos-related diseases. These funds were established by companies who manufactured or sold asbestos-containing products and ended up in bankruptcy. These companies were ordered by bankruptcy courts to put funds in trusts to compensate victims of asbestos case [Internet Page]-containing products.

Each asbestos trust has distinct eligibility requirements that must be met for victims to receive financial compensation. A mesothelioma lawyer can help victims understand these requirements and gather the documents they need to make an application. This includes proof of employment, military service documents and complete medical records that demonstrate the victim was diagnosed with an asbestos-related disease.

Mesothelioma lawyers also aid victims in filing for expedited review at each asbestos compensation trust fund. This could speed up the processing of claims and increase the amount of money awarded to a victim. There is a cap on the amount a person is able to receive through an expedited review.

Depending on the extent of a victim's asbestos-related condition It is possible for them to receive low six figures or more in total compensation through the asbestos settlement trust fund system. This compensation is designed to pay for a variety of expenses, including mesothelioma treatment funeral costs, lost income and future losses.

Settlements

Asbestos victims can file legal claims to recover compensation. Compensation may include a cash settlement or a jury verdict. The amount of compensation is determined by the type and severity of the asbestos-related illness as well as the victim's decreased quality of life, the loss of earnings and medical expenses. An attorney for mesothelioma will analyze your case and provide you the options available for compensation.

Most mesothelioma cases are settled outside of court. Companies that are defendants don't want to incur the cost of trial, therefore they settle their cases relatively early in the legal process.

Mesothelioma lawyers are experienced in mesothelioma cases and can quickly identify viable sources of compensation. They will often go through the purchase orders of decades ago and witness statements, as well as look through other documents to determine the asbestos exposure in a particular area.

The companies who extracted and manufactured asbestos and who made and used asbestos-containing products must compensate victims of mesothelioma. The victims are typically exposed workers who's rights were violated when the defendants knew that they were placing them in the vicinity of this carcinogen that is extremely dangerous.

In most states, people diagnosed with mesothelioma have the right to sue the companies that caused the harm. These lawsuits are referred to as mesothelioma or personal injury lawsuits.

Workers' compensation claims can be filed by people or their loved ones who have been diagnosed with asbestos-related ailments. These claims can be used to cover medical costs and income loss. These claims are usually filed with the state workers compensation office. Check if you are eligible for government-run health insurance programs such as Medicare and Medicaid. These programs provide health insurance to those over 65 and people with low incomes.

Veterans who were exposed to asbestos legal while in the military are eligible for VA benefits. VA benefits can cover the cost of treatment at some of the most prominent mesothelioma centers and also provide a monthly disability payment that is based upon the severity of a service-related illness or injury such as mesothelioma. These benefits are not in conflict with the filing of an injury lawsuit or VA disability compensation claim. Veterans must file both claims to receive the maximum amount of compensation.
